I wanted to share a recent experience that might help fellow Indian applicants avoid falling into a trap.
Shortly after registering on the official ETS portal, I received an email from
Code:
register4toefl[at]etsindia[dot]org
. The domain looked official — especially since visiting
etsindia[dot]org redirected me to
ets[dot]org, which initially gave it legitimacy in my eyes.
The email claimed to offer a
special benefit, and I was asked to initiate a
WhatsApp chat to receive it. After a brief conversation, I got a call from someone named
Prabhat S. (last name partially withheld for privacy). He told me I’d need to
pay a certain amount to a private company account, after which I’d receive a
16-digit code that would reduce the TOEFL fee to zero during registration on the ETS portal.
I didn’t proceed with the payment. Instead, the unusual request made me scrutinize the setup more closely, and I realized this was a
cleverly disguised fraud not linked to ETS. It was clearly designed to exploit students by impersonating a legitimate service.
While I’ve chosen not to take legal action right now due to my ongoing prep, I wanted to put this warning out so others can stay alert. Please don’t trust unofficial emails or pay fees to unknown accounts.
